What Types of Mental Health Issues Does Agape Youth Behavioral Health Treat?

The spectrum of mental health challenges faced by adolescents is vast. Agape Youth Behavioral Health recognizes this complexity and equips its team to address a wide array of issues. They often provide support for adolescents struggling with:

  • Depression: The pervasive sadness and hopelessness that can consume a young person's life.
  • Anxiety: The overwhelming fear and worry that interfere with daily functioning.
  • Trauma: The lasting emotional wounds inflicted by adverse experiences.
  • Substance abuse: The harmful dependence on drugs or alcohol, often masking underlying emotional pain.
  • Eating disorders: The distorted body image and unhealthy eating patterns that can have devastating consequences.
  • ADHD: Attention deficit hyperactivity disorder, affecting focus and impulsivity.
  • Oppositional Defiant Disorder (ODD): A pattern of angry or irritable mood, argumentative behavior, or vindictiveness.

What is the Admission Process Like at Agape Youth Behavioral Health?

The admission process typically begins with an initial assessment to evaluate the adolescent's needs and determine the appropriate level of care. This assessment often involves interviews with the young person, their family, and possibly their school or other relevant individuals. The goal is to develop a comprehensive understanding of the challenges faced and to create a personalized treatment plan tailored to their unique circumstances. The process itself aims to be supportive and reassuring, minimizing any further stress or anxiety for the adolescent and their family.

Is Agape Youth Behavioral Health a Residential Treatment Center?

While specifics on the type of treatment settings offered will vary depending on the individual Agape location and program, many similar facilities provide a range of options, including residential and outpatient programs. Residential treatment offers a more intensive, structured environment, while outpatient programs allow adolescents to continue living at home while receiving therapy and support. The choice of setting is determined collaboratively with the young person and their family, based on their individual needs and circumstances.
